Assertion: Soft iron is used as a core of transformer.
Reason: Area of hysteresis loop for soft iron is small.

Answer

  1. Both A and R are true and R is the correct explanation of A.
Explanation:
The alternating current flowing through the coils, magnetises and demagnetises the iron core again and again over complete cycles. During each cycle of magnetisation, some energy is lost due to hysteresis, the energy lost during a cycle of magnetisation being equal to area of hysteresis loop (in magnitude). Energy loss can be reduce by selecting the material core, which has narrow hysteresis loop, that is why soft iron core is used.
